Prep 2027 Transition Program @ FWPS

Starting Prep is a big step for your child and for the whole family. Footscray West offers pre-school information sessions, local kindergarten visits, classroom activity programs, and social events so everyone can settle in and enjoy this exciting time.

 

What activities are offered in our transition program for Prep 2027 students?

Please note that the following events are for enrolled students only. These activities give students the opportunity to mix with their peers and familiarise themselves with the school environment between October and December.

 

All families will receive a personalised email with the details of the transition program for their child prior to the transition program commencing.

  • Kindergarten visits by the transition coordinator (throughout Term 3 and 4 of 2026): Between enrolment confirmation and the transition sessions, our Transition Coordinator will visit the local kindergartens and early childhood settings to speak with the educators and to meet many of our enrolling students.
  • Welcome visit (Monday 12th October 2026): This 40 minute session takes place outside and gives students an opportunity to play with some of our sports equipment, blow some bubbles and sing some songs. The purpose of this visit is for the children to participate in an informal school experience alongside their parent or carer, which builds their familiarity with our school and staff in a way that feels safe and supported. Multiple sessions are held throughout the day  and more information will be provided closer to the event for enrolled families.
  • Parent information session (Wednesday 21st October 2026, 6:00pm-8:00pm): This session is presented to parents and carers in the evening. It will outline important information to support every 2027 Prep student’s Transition to School. *Please note this is an adult only event.
  • Playground and story experience (Thursday 22nd October 2026): This 40 minute event begins with a play on our playground and then moves inside to our Gallery space where children will listen to a story read by a teacher and sing some familiar songs. The purpose of this visit is for the children to participate in an informal school experience alongside their parent or carer, which builds their familiarity with our school and staff in a way that feels safe and supported. Multiple sessions are held throughout the day  and more information will be provided closer to the event for enrolled families.
  • Classroom transition session #1 (Monday 26th of October 2026): This 45 minute session allows children the opportunity to be in a Prep classroom to play, meet a Prep teacher and listen to a story.
